5 CONVEYOR PULLEY SELECTION GUIDE Pulley/Core Diameter – The outside diameter of the cylindrical body of a conveyor pulley, without coating. Finish Diameter – The outside diameter of a coated pulley (core diameter + 2 times the coating/wrap thickness). Face Width – The length of a pulley''s cylindrical area is intended to act as the contact surface for the conveyor belt.

The drive is positioned directly In the driving pulley. This conveyor belt design has a very simple construction and has minimal maintenance requirements. This design is preferable if there are no space restrictions. MOTOR BELOW. To reduce the width of the conveyor, the drive is positioned below the actual conveyor belt.
A belt conveyor system consists of two or more pulleys (sometimes referred to as drums pulleys), with an endless loop of carrying medium—the conveyor belt—that rotates about them. One or both of the pulleys are powered, moving the belt and the material on the belt forward. The powered pulley is called the drive pulley while the unpowered ...
· Drive Loion. Drives can be loed in different places on conveyor systems. A head or end drive is found on the discharge side of the conveyor and is the most common type. Center drives are not always at the actual center of the conveyor, but somewhere along its length, and are mounted underneath the system.

S = Screw Conveyor Speed. The torque rating of the drive shaft, coupling shafts, coupling bolts and conveyor screw must be greater than Full Motor Torque for proper design. A 12inch diameter screw conveyor was selected for the example. The minimum standard shaft size for a 12inch diameter screw conveyor is 2inch diameter.

· Example: – Model TA, 11 ft long requires 1/2 Hp motor at 65 Feet per minute for a total load of 320 pounds. – You desire your conveyor to operate at 90 Feet Per Minute. – Calculate as follows: (1/2 X 90) / 65 = .69. – You should select the next highest horsepower or 3/4 Hp. If operating conditions changed after the conveyor drive was designed and installed and the 20 HP motor was required to draw 2,000 pounds at 402 feet per minute, it would be attempting to provide 804,000 foot pounds per minute of power, which is approximately 24 HP. While doing this, the motor would attempt to draw 30 amps.
